Where are you failing to resolve names?  Can you resolve them from the
firewall but not from the workstations?  Can you ping IP's from the
workstations?

You can override the resolv.conf by a switch on the line that calls "pump"
(I think it's "pump -r" or "-n", check the --help or manpage.

> Setup:
> OpenBSD firewall on a Pentium 133, running IPF and IPNAT
> RedHat 7.2 on my desktop, Pentium 500
>
> Hey all.  I just moved to Praire Village, but with no DSL access I
> switched to Road Runner.  I reconfigured my external NIC to use DHCP and
> the session appears to open successfully.  The problem is DNS isn't
> working.  The resolv.conf file is rewritten  with  a "search" on the
> kc.rr.com domain and the three RR DNS servers as "nameserver"s.  I can
> ping external IPs, but I just can't resolve names.  I even tried
> reconfiguring my desktop to use the old DSL nameservers to no avail.
>  Any suggestions?
